Dill and parsley contain a large amount of vitamins and minerals that can have a beneficial effect on the body. Dill is rich in vitamins A, C and K, and also contains folic acid, iron, calcium and other minerals. It can help improve digestion, lower blood pressure and strengthen the immune system.
Parsley also contains many vitamins and minerals. It is especially rich in vitamin K, which helps blood clot, and vitamin C, which strengthens the immune system. Parsley also helps lower cholesterol, improve eyesight and strengthen bones.
